Andrea Kienle recently celebrated her 25-year anniversary in the UN system. Her UN journey started as a JPO in New York in the UN Secretariat in the Department of Human Resources Management (HRM), being responsible for designing a  managed mobility programme as well as a structured learning programme for P-2s. 

She always remained in the area of HR, with a strong focus on staff development. After HRM she moved to the Department of Peacekeeping Operations (DPKO), being part of the first training team. There she learnt to build bridges and finding common ground between military, police and civilian staff as well as finding pragmatic solutions for situations in the field. 

In 2005 she joined the United Nations Office in Vienna (UNOV/UNODC) as the Chief of Staff Development. She and her team provides learning opportunities to staff in the field. This is also what she did as the Chief of Staff Development in the Organization for Security and Co-operation in Europe (OSCE) between 2007 and 2017.  

Currently at UNIDO Andrea leads the Talent Development and Performance Management team, facilitating learning solutions for everyone and empowering UNIDO’s diverse talent to thrive.
